Building access — temporary site (Larkspur Annex). While Merrow House is under renovation, all staff work from the Larkspur Annex on Cobb Yard. Entrance is the blue door beside the bike racks; main doors are construction access only. Badges from Merrow House do not work here yet — Facilities will reissue within your first week. Deliveries go to the annex rear hatch. Until your badge is reissued, enter using the code below.

door code, yagap-bahof: bdg-O-05

**Q: A customer says Tidybranch deleted a branch they still needed. Can we restore it?**

A: Yes. The Tidybranch stale-branch cleanup bot archives every branch it removes for 90 days before permanent deletion. Open the Tidybranch admin console, locate the customer's repository, and select Restore from Archive. Restores on enterprise tenants require unlocking the archive vault first, which support leads are authorized to do. Unlock it by entering the recovery passphrase shown on the line below.

unlock words, yawig-kagef: gordor-holvan-ulaael-pramir-ulaiel-tamdor

## Authentication

The nightly reindex job for Quillhurst Search runs under a dedicated service identity with read-only access to the document store and write access to the staging index alias. Credentials are rotated every 14 days and are never logged; the job fails closed if rotation lags. For the purposes of this security review, the job authenticates to the indexing API using the bearer token reproduced below.

portal login ticket: eyJhbGciOiJIUzI1NiIsInR5cCI6IkpXVCJ9.eyJzdWIiOiIwEOsktwVNwIn0.-UJU3fdyyCgG

(1) Happy path: records past the 90-day window get soft-deleted, tombstones written. (2) Edge: records with legal-hold flags must survive every pass — there's a dedicated assertion for this, don't let anyone weaken it. (3) Failure: sweeper crashes mid-batch, restart resumes from the checkpoint without double-deleting.

Run the suite against the Larkspur staging cluster, not local — timing behavior differs. The staging sweeper API requires authentication; use the bearer token below.

login token, bagug-kafop: eyJhbGciOiJIUzI1NiIsInR5cCI6IkpXVCJ9.eyJzdWIiOiIcMLov2In0.Z5RLDIfp